The COP31 Presidency has put forward a proposal aimed at increasing the global share of final energy demand satisfied by electricity from slightly above 20 percent to 35 percent by the year 2035. This initiative seeks to encourage nations to collectively enhance their reliance on electricity as a primary energy source. The proposal reflects a strategic effort to transition towards more sustainable energy practices on a global scale. Further discussions and negotiations are expected to take place among participating countries to assess the feasibility and implementation of this target.
